North Branch, MN: what the federal noise map shows

At North Branch, MN, road, rail and aircraft noise all fall below the 45 dB(A) floor BTS's national map can distinguish from silence. This describes North Branch as a whole, not a specific block, the underlying BTS map resolves to about 38 meters per pixel, sampled at the town's own center point.

Where North Branch ranks

North Branch is one of 8,515 places in this dataset with no measurable transportation noise at all, too quiet to rank on loudness. By population, it ranks 2,778 of the 12,137 places in this dataset, home to about 12,258 people.
